On , OSHA opened a complaint safety inspection of US POSTAL SERVICE in 25 DORCHESTER AVENUE, BOSTON, MA 02205 (NAICS 491110). OSHA activity number 346606692.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.178(l)(4)(ii)(B):Refresher training in relevant topics was not provided to the operator when the operator was involved in an accident or near-miss incident: Location: Main Street On about March 7, 2023, an employee was operating a battery powered Toyota forklift and was involved in a near miss collision with a battery powered Toyota long-forked riding pallet jack and was allowed to continue to operate the forklift for the remainder of the shift and during the employee's work schedule from March 7, 2023 through March 16, 2023 without being retrained.

29 CFR 1910.178(q)(7):Industrial trucks were not examined before being placed in service: Location: Main Street On or about March 7, 2023, a battery powered Toyota long-forked riding pallet jack was not examined prior to use and was involved in a near miss collision with a battery powered Toyota forklift, where the employee was injured when the employee's foot got stuck in a gap between the cowling and the standing platform as the employee fell after sudden braking.

29 CFR 1910.37(a)(3):Exit route(s) were not kept free and unobstructed: Locations: 1. New Building Third Floor: Emergency Exit by Column A-35 blocked by rolling tub rack. 2. New Building Third Floor: Emergency Exit Door Stairway 4. Rat trap on the floor in front of the door. 3. New Building Third Floor: Emergency Exit Door Stairway 5. Rat trap on floor in front of the door's left side. 4. New Building Third Floor: Emergency Exit Door West Wall-Stairway 6 mail tub wedged under door. Door partially open. On or about April 3, 2023, exit doors were blocked or partially blocked exposing employees to burns, smoke inhalation and tripping hazards in the event employees have to egress the building due to a fire or an emergency. The US Postal Service was previously cited for a violation of this occupational safety and health standard or its equivalent standard 29 CFR 1910.37(a)(3), which was contained in OSHA inspection number 1458900, citation number 1, item number 2 and was affirmed as a final order on May 13, 2020, with respect to a workplace located at US Postal Service's Marina Station, 270 de la Candelaria Mayaguez, PR 00682.

29 CFR 1910.157(c)(1):Portable fire extinguishers were not mounted, located and identified so that they were readily accessible without subjecting the employees to injuries: Location: New Building On or about April 3, 2023, Third Floor Exit 1 Door, a portable fire extinguisher was not mounted.
